What Is the GF Score?

The GF Score is a stock performance ranking system developed by GuruFocus using five aspects of valuation, which has been found to be closely correlated to the long-term performances of stocks by backtesting from 2006 to 2021. The stocks with a higher GF Score generally generate higher returns than those with a lower GF Score. Therefore, when picking stocks, investors should invest in companies with high GF Scores. The GF Score ranges from 0 to 100, with 100 as the highest rank.

Understanding Generac Holdings Inc's Business

Generac Holdings Inc, with a market cap of $8.08 billion and sales of $4.02 billion, is a leading name in the design and manufacture of power generation equipment. Serving residential, commercial, and industrial markets, it offers standby generators, portable generators, lighting, outdoor power equipment, and a suite of clean energy products. The majority of its sales are generated in the United States, reflecting a strong domestic presence. With an operating margin of 9.61%, Generac Holdings Inc demonstrates efficient management and profitability in its operations.
